آموزش اصول ASP.NET MVC 3.0

ASP.NET MVC 3.0 Fundamentals

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: در این دوره ما به ویژگی های جدید چارچوب ASP.NET MVC 3.0، از جمله موتور نمای جدید Razor، ویژگی های جدید AJAX بدون مزاحمت، مدیریت بسته NuGet و غیره خواهیم پرداخت.

سرفصل ها و درس ها

مقدمه ای بر ASP.NET MVC 3.0 Introduction to ASP.NET MVC 3.0

  • بررسی اجمالی Overview

  • پروژه جدید New Project

  • الگوی MVC The MVC Pattern

  • مسیریابی Routing

  • کنترل کننده ها Controllers

  • بازدیدها Views

  • نمایش فهرست Showing A List

  • ایجاد اکشن Create Action

  • خلاصه Summary

Razor و ASP.NET MVC 3.0 Razor and ASP.NET MVC 3.0

  • معرفی Introduction

  • اهداف تیغ Razor's Goals

  • ایجاد یک نمای ساده Creating A Simple View

  • ترکیب کد و نشانه گذاری Intermingling Code and Markup

  • مدل ها و ViewData Models and ViewData

  • راهنماهای HTML HTML Helpers

  • نماهای جزئی Partial Views

  • نماهای چیدمان Layout Views

  • کد راه اندازی Startup Code

  • پیکربندی Configuration

  • خلاصه Summary

کنترلرها در ASP.NET MVC 3.0 Controllers in ASP.NET MVC 3.0

  • معرفی Introduction

  • فیلترهای عمل جهانی Global Action Filters

  • حافظه پنهان اقدامات کودک Caching Child Actions

  • ViewBag The ViewBag

  • نتایج اقدام جدید New Action Results

  • درخواست اعتبار سنجی Request Validation

  • خلاصه Summary

مدل ها در ASP.NET MVC 3.0 Models in ASP.NET MVC 3.0

  • معرفی Introduction

  • اعتبار سنجی در MVC 3 Validation in MVC 3

  • حاشیه نویسی داده ها Data Annotations

  • ویژگی های اعتبار سنجی سفارشی Custom Validation Attributes

  • مدل های خود اعتبارسنجی Self-validating models

  • اعتبار سنجی مشتری Client validation

  • اعتبار سنجی مشتری سفارشی Custom client validation

  • اعتبار سنجی از راه دور Remote validation

  • خلاصه Summary

مدیریت بسته NuGet NuGet Package Management

  • معرفی Introduction

  • مدیریت بسته Package Management

  • آنها از کجا می آیند؟ Where Do They Come From?

  • کجا میرن؟ Where Do They Go?

  • وابستگی های بسته Package Dependencies

  • بوت استرپینگ Bootstrapping

  • پاورشل Powershell

  • بسته های سفارشی Custom Packages

  • خلاصه Summary

وضوح وابستگی در ASP.NET MVC 3.0 Dependency Resolution in ASP.NET MVC 3.0

  • معرفی Introduction

  • رزولوشن وابستگی Dependency Resolution

  • فواید Benefits

  • IDependencyResolver IDependencyResolver

  • تزریق کنترلر Controller Injection

  • مشاهده تزریق View Injection

  • فعال کننده ها Activators

  • توسعه پذیری فیلتر Filter Extensibility

  • توسعه پذیری مرتبط با مدل Model Related Extensiblity

  • خلاصه Summary

نمایش نظرات

آموزش اصول ASP.NET MVC 3.0
جزییات دوره
3h 17m
55
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
730
4.5 از 5
دارد
دارد
دارد
Scott Allen
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Scott Allen Scott Allen

اسکات در طول 15 سال فعالیت در توسعه نرم افزار تجاری روی همه چیز از دستگاه های جاسازی شده 8 بیتی تا وب سایت های مقیاس بزرگ کار کرده است. از سال 2001 ، اسکات بر روی فناوری سرور و وب مانند ASP.NET ، ASP.NET AJAX ، Windows Workflow ، Silverlight و LINQ تمرکز کرده است. اسکات همچنین در کنفرانس های ملی مانند VSLive سخنران است ، و همچنین در اردوگاه های کد و گروه های کاربری در نزدیکی زادگاهش Hagerstown ، MD. اسکات از سال 2005 بعنوان MVP مایکروسافت شناخته شده است و چندین کتاب در زمینه فن آوریهای مایکروسافت نوشته و یا در تألیف آنها همکاری کرده است. اسکات سایت OdeToCode.com را در سال 2004 تأسیس کرد و در سال 2007 به Pluralsight پیوست.